|
SATA Testing
In order to streamline and simplify interface connections
between PCs and storage devices, many companies today
are using Serial ATA (SATA) interfaces. Compared to
parallel ATA, SATA simplifies the interface hardware
by using fewer cables and smaller connectors, taking
up less PCB real estate, and therefore reducing the
overall system cost as well as potential for failure.
SATA also offers increased data transfer speeds and easier
system configuration capabilities.
Percept Technology Labs now delivers specialized SATA testing at both the command-level and protocol-level.
- Command-level Testing - Using
custom test tools, Percept runs systematic tests to
verify that the target device executes both SATA and
ATAPI/SCSI commands correctly. Percept test tools
support both disk and tape device testing with a collection
of exhaustive test scripts. This testing assures that
all required and optional commands are being communicated
and executed as required by SATA and SCSI standards.
Any potential problems discovered during testing can
be addressed and fixed, preempting expensive field
problems and customer satisfaction issues.
- Protocol-level Testing - In addition
to command-level testing, Percept is able to test
the SATA link at the protocol level. Using specialized
tools, our experienced staff is able to simulate protocol
errors and verify that systems are able to recognize
and recover link-level exceptions as they occur. This
type of testing allows Percept to exercise additional
functionality not covered during the regular course
of testing, that may have significant influence on
the stability and robustness of the data subsystem.
- Interoperability testing - Percept can also verify that SATA devices function correctly with the wide variety of SATA equipment currently available on the market – assuring seamless integration into the customer environment, and avoiding product launch surprises and future support problems.
|
Receive your quote right away :
Learn about
SATA testing and receive a quote to meet your specific needs.
Call Us: 303.444.7480 Toll Free: 1-866-324-4286
Or fill out this form:
|